A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

When existing refrigerators are installed in a built-in manner, especially when the depth is less than that of the cabinet, they are prone to moving backwards, and the freezer drawer door needs to be opened forcefully when a large amount of food is placed, causing the refrigerator to be dragged. The existing adjustment foot design cannot be fully fixed.

Method used

A depth adjustment mechanism is designed, including a fixing seat, an adjusting rod and a connecting head. The adjusting rod can be retracted and locked, and the connecting head can be pressed against the wall. The adjusting rod drives the connecting head to connect with the wall to achieve embedding depth limitation and stable fixation.

Benefits of technology

It effectively prevents the refrigerator from shifting when the door is opened, ensures the aesthetics and stability of the embedded installation, and improves the fixing effect of the refrigerator in the cabinet.

Abstract

The utility model discloses a depth adjusting mechanism and a refrigerator, the depth adjusting mechanism comprises a fixing seat, an adjusting assembly and a connector, and the fixing seat is fixedly mounted on the top of a refrigerator body; the adjusting assembly comprises an adjusting rod and a locking piece, the adjusting rod is installed on the fixing base in a telescopic mode, the adjusting rod can extend outwards from the refrigerator top in the depth direction of the refrigerator body, and the portion, extending out of the refrigerator top, of the adjusting rod can be locked to the fixing base through the locking piece; the connector is installed at the end, extending out of the box top, of the adjusting rod, the connector can abut against the wall face under driving of the adjusting rod, and the connector is made to be connected with the wall face. In this way, the embedded depth of the refrigerator can be limited when the embedded cabinet is installed, meanwhile, by means of connection between the connector and the wall face, the effect of stabilizing and fixing the installation of the refrigerator is achieved, the refrigerator is prevented from shifting when the door is opened, and the service life of the refrigerator is prolonged. In this way, the attractiveness of the refrigerator with the depth adjusting mechanism can be ensured when the refrigerator is installed in a cabinet in an embedded mode.

Technical Field

[0001] The utility model belongs to the technical field related to embedded installation of refrigerators, and in particular relates to a depth adjustment mechanism and a refrigerator. Background Art

[0002] To ensure stable placement in the user's home, the refrigerator's bottom features adjustable feet for leveling and stability. Furthermore, to facilitate movement during installation, the refrigerator relies primarily on rollers on the compressor baseplate assembly. Once the installer has moved the refrigerator to its designated location, they adjust the adjustable feet to level the refrigerator, ensuring it remains stable and resists shaking or movement.

[0003] The current refrigerator products on the market do not consider the problem of depth adjustment, especially for built-in refrigerators whose depth is less than the depth of the user's cabinet. During installation, the exterior surface of the refrigerator door is ensured to be flush with the cabinet. The problem of the refrigerator moving backward is only reduced by adjusting the grip of the feet. There is no design measure to completely solve this problem. After the refrigerator is installed, the user may accidentally push the refrigerator when using it, and the refrigerator will still move backward. At the same time, when the freezer drawer door of some refrigerators is pulled out, when there is a lot of food in the drawer, it takes a lot of pulling force to open the door, which will cause the refrigerator to be dragged. There are two main reasons for this problem: (1) The installer did not adjust the adjusting feet to the optimal position; (2) When the adjusting feet are adjusted to the optimal position, when the freezer drawer door of some refrigerators is pulled out, when there is a lot of food in the drawer, it takes a lot of pulling force to open the door, which will also cause the refrigerator to be dragged; (3) The refrigerator cannot be completely fixed by relying solely on the adjusting feet for leveling and stability. Therefore, other designs are needed to ensure that the refrigerator is more stable and fixed. Utility Model Content

[0040] The depth adjustment mechanism 100, for which protection is sought in this application, is mounted on a refrigerator body 200 and is used to limit the depth of the refrigerator body 200 when embedded within a cabinet. Of course, in other embodiments, the depth adjustment mechanism 100 can also be mounted on appliances requiring embedded installation, such as washing machines and ovens, but this will not be elaborated upon here.

[0041] like Figure 1 As shown, the depth adjustment mechanism 100 provided in one embodiment of the present application includes a fixing seat 10, an adjustment assembly 20 and a connecting head 30. The fixing seat 10 is fixedly mounted on the box top 210 of the refrigerator body 200; the adjustment assembly 20 includes an adjusting rod 21 and a locking member 22. The adjusting rod 21 is telescopically mounted on the fixing seat 10, and the adjusting rod 21 can extend outward from the box top 210 in the depth direction of the refrigerator body 200, and the adjusting rod 21 extending outward from the box top 210 can be locked to the fixing seat 10 by the locking member 22; the connecting head 30 is mounted on one end of the adjusting rod 21 extending out of the box top 210, and the connecting head 30 can be pressed against a wall (not shown) under the drive of the adjusting rod 21, and the connecting head 30 is connected to the wall.

[0042] It can be understood that when the depth adjustment mechanism 100 is applied to a refrigerator, the adjustment rod 21 can drive the connecting head 30 to extend out of the box top 210 in the depth direction of the refrigerator body 200 and rest against the wall, so as to limit the embedded depth of the refrigerator when it is installed in the embedded cabinet. At the same time, the connection between the connecting head 30 and the wall can be used to stabilize and fix the installation of the refrigerator, preventing the refrigerator from shifting when the door is opened. This can ensure the aesthetics of the refrigerator when it is embedded in the cabinet with the depth adjustment mechanism 100.

[0043] like Figure 1As shown, the fixing base 10 includes a first fixing plate 11 and a second fixing plate 12, and the first fixing plate 11 and the second fixing plate 12 are arranged at intervals along the depth direction of the refrigerator body 200; wherein, the adjustment rod 21 is set through the first fixing plate 11 and the second fixing plate 12, and realizes the assembly connection of the adjustment rod 21 on the fixing base 10. Here, a connecting plate 13 is connected between the first fixing plate 11 and the second fixing plate 12, and the first fixing plate 11 and the second fixing plate 12 are bent in opposite directions and form a first mounting plate 14 and a second mounting plate 15, so that the fixing base 10 can be fixedly connected to the refrigerator body 200 through the first mounting plate 14 and the second mounting plate 15. Preferably, the fixing base 10 is configured as an integrated sheet metal part. It should be noted that both the first fixing plate 11 and the second fixing plate 12 are provided with through holes for the adjustment rod 21 to pass through.

[0044] like Figure 2 、 Figure 3 As shown, the depth adjustment mechanism 100 further includes a connector 101. The connector 101 passes through the fixing base 10 and is screwed to the reinforcing iron 220 in the box top 210, thereby securing the fixing base 10 to the box top 210. The threaded engagement between the connector 101 and the reinforcing iron 220 facilitates assembly of the fixing base 10 to the box top 210. Two connectors 101 are provided, one of which passes through the first mounting plate 14 and is screwed to the reinforcing iron 220, and the other of which passes through the second mounting plate 15 and is screwed to the reinforcing iron 220. Specifically, the connectors 101 are configured as screws or bolts.

[0045] like Figure 1 As shown, the locking member 22 is configured as a locking nut 221. The locking nut 221 is threadedly connected to the adjustment rod 21 and abuts against the fixing base 10, and is used to limit the adjustment rod 21 to the fixing base 10. In this way, the threaded matching structure between the locking nut 221 and the adjustment rod 21 allows the user to adjust the installation position of the adjustment rod 21 on the fixing base 10 by screwing the adjustment rod 21. This facilitates the adjustment of the installation position of the adjustment rod 21 on the fixing base 10 and allows for arbitrary adjustment of the installation position. Here, the adjustment rod 21 is configured as an adjustment screw.

[0046] As preferably, Figure 1 As shown, there are two locking nuts 221, which are arranged on both sides of the fixing base 10. This can improve the stability of the installation position of the adjustment rod 21 when it is fixed to the fixing base 10. Here, one locking nut 221 is arranged on the outside of the first fixing plate 11 and abuts against the first fixing plate 11, and the other locking nut 221 is arranged on the outside of the second fixing plate 12 and abuts against the second fixing plate 12.

[0047] like Figure 1 、 Figure 2 As shown, the connector 30 is configured as a flexible member 31; wherein the connector 30 is sleeved on the adjustment rod 21 and tightly fits with the adjustment rod 21, which facilitates the assembly of the connector 30 to the adjustment rod 21. Moreover, when the depth adjustment mechanism 100 is used in a refrigerator and the embedding depth of the refrigerator body 200 in the cabinet is adjusted, the material properties of the flexible member 31 can provide a buffering effect when the connector 30 abuts against the wall, thereby preventing damage to the wall. Here, the flexible member 31 is configured as a shock-absorbing silicone pad, a shock-absorbing rubber pad, etc.

[0048] like Figure 1 、 Figure 2 As shown, a patch 40 is connected to the connector 30, and the connector 30 can be pressed against the wall through the patch 40; the patch 40 is coated with an adhesive (not shown), and when the patch 40 is pressed against the wall, the patch 40 and the wall can be connected by the adhesive. In other words, when the connector 30 is pressed against the wall, it can be attached to the wall by gluing, which facilitates the connection between the connector 30 and the wall and simplifies the structure. Here, the patch 40 is specifically a metal sheet. Of course, in other embodiments, the adhesive can also be directly applied to the connector 30.

[0049] like Figure 1 As shown, the patch 40 is independently provided relative to the connector 30; wherein, the patch 40 can be connected to the connector 30 by gluing, which can facilitate the assembly and connection of the patch 40 on the connector 30. Here, the patch 40 can also be coated with an adhesive, and the patch 40 can be fixed to the connector 30 by the adhesive, so that the patch 40 can be assembled on the connector 30 in a directionally-controlled manner, thereby facilitating the assembly and connection of the patch 40 on the connector 30.

[0050] like Figure 3 As shown, the present application further provides a refrigerator, comprising a refrigerator body 200 and the depth adjustment mechanism 100 described above, wherein the depth adjustment mechanism 100 is mounted on the top 210 of the refrigerator body 200. Here, the depth adjustment mechanism 100 is assembled to the lower portion of the refrigerator body 200 and does not extend beyond the highest portion of the refrigerator body 200, so that when the depth adjustment mechanism 100 is assembled on the refrigerator body 200, it does not affect the overall height of the refrigerator body 200.

[0051] like Figure 3As shown, two sets of depth adjustment mechanisms 100 are provided, spaced apart along the width of the refrigerator body 200. This allows the refrigerator to use two sets of depth adjustment mechanisms 100 to adjust its depth within the cabinet, thereby improving the stability of the refrigerator when its depth is fixed within the cabinet. Of course, in other embodiments, the number of depth adjustment mechanisms 100 can be one, three, or even more sets, which will not be elaborated here.

[0052] From the above, it can be seen that when the refrigerator of the present application needs to be embedded in a cabinet, the length of the adjustment rod 21 extending backward from the refrigerator body 200 in the depth direction of the refrigerator body 200 can be adjusted according to the depth of the refrigerator embedded in the cabinet and the depth of the refrigerator body 200, and then the refrigerator can be moved as a whole into the cabinet until the patch 40 of the connecting head 30 on the adjustment rod 21 rests on the wall so that the patch 40 is connected to the wall, so that the refrigerator door on the refrigerator body 200 can be flush with the cabinet.
